Rockhampton Regional Council requires a qualified service provider with capability to undertake the pole asset services while complying with legislative, industry standards, and codes of practice to provide safe and reliable function of various pole assets while achieving minimum disruption to electrical distribution.The Service Provider will also provide inspections, data acquisition, analysis, and reports.This contract is for the inspection, condition reporting and emergency repairs on pole assets constructed of timber, or lights towers/tall poles greater than 8 metres, associated with electrical property poles and/or electrical equipment (e.g. light fittings, aerial consumer mains and aerial sub-mains).

Located in the heart of Central Queensland, the Rockhampton Region is situated 570 km north of Brisbane and approximately 300 km south of Mackay. The Region spans an area that-s covers the communities of Mount Morgan and Gracemere and boasts the City of Rockhampton as the main service centre for the wider Central Queensland Region.
